We are very pleased to hear today's announcement by the Defence Secretary that RAF Benson is to receive a further 6 Merlin Helicopters from the Danish Government, increasing the Merlin fleet to 28. It is expected that the new Merlins should have a deployable capability by 2008 providing a welcome boost to RAF Benson's ability to provide direct support to the UK Army both in the UK and on operations wherever the capability is required. The news will mean a lot of hard work in the months ahead for RAF Benson's personnel as they look to incorporate the new aircraft into the Merlin Fleet alongside 28(Army Cooperation) Squadron's current aircraft, but their professionalism, dedication and good humour will ensure that RAF Benson continues to make a vital contribution to UK Defence policy.
